What Are Online Games?
Online Games are video games that can be played through a computer console or mobile device connected to the Internet. They can range from browser-based multiplayer titles to downloadable video game titles that require an Internet connection for play. The history of online games dates back to some of the earliest computer technologies. In the 1970s, many universities were linked through ARPANET, a precursor to the Internet. This allowed students to connect their computers and terminals to a central server and interact with each other in what was close to real-time. The first online games were text-based but soon advanced to include high-end graphics and virtual worlds populated by multiple players simultaneously.
